Just Back From Patagonia and Wine Country

Exploring Argentina and Chile

 

“Stephanie and I love Knowmad’s attention to detail, that we never feel pushed in one direction or another during our decision-making process, and that the trips always are comfortable, authentic, and culturally immersive.

Our two-week itinerary was a great combination of exploring the culture of Buenos Aires; Los Glaciares National Park and nearby estancias; the beauty and adventure of Torres del Paine; the Chilean seaside port city of Valparaíso; and a wind-down at a luxury vineyard residence in the Apalta Valley. The trip had a great flow.

Adventures with Knowmad Travelers through Chile and Argentina

 

Starting off in Buenos Aires, we thought Palermo was a great area to stay with easy walkability to many shops, bars, and restaurants, and also a couple of open-air markets.

Jessica took us to a few out-of-the-way locations on the Jewish Heritage tour and even included a home visit to one of her friends who was an artist and a survivor of the AMIA bombing in 1994. We were invited in for a coffee break which was a very special experience. We saw a Tango show at El Querandi in San Telmo and had dinner beforehand at Mishiguene, a Michelin top 50 restaurant in South America. It was a nice change of pace and an excellent dining experience.

Because of airline schedule changes, our pick-up time was adjusted one day. We were contacted by Cami, the local Knowmad rep, and it all worked out. It was nice to know that Knowmad was there for us when needed!

When l saw the deep blue Lago Argentina on our final approach, I felt more excited than ever in all our travels to actually be arriving at our long-awaited destination. We had planned this trip based on the Patagonia experience as its core, and here we were, after years of having this on our radar! The day at Perito Moreno Glacier was spectacular.

On to Explora Salto Chico in Torres del Paine, where it was fairly blustery during our stay, but the weather came in waves, so we were able to get the true Patagonia experience. The views were unreal! We did some amazing hikes. Horseback riding to Laguna Negri was awesome: the gauchos were excellent, the horses beautiful and well-trained, and it was nice cross-country riding, even for a novice.

We then headed to Valparaiso in central Chile, a very colorful hillside port city and the place to go for amazing seafood with beautiful views. Casa Higueras was a fine choice; upscale, a nice restaurant for dinner, breakfast on the terrace overlooking the port, and easy to walk to shops, restaurants and the cultural center. The streets and alleyways were covered in beautiful street art.

After 10 days of adventure, it was time to relax in wine country. The villa at Apalta Residence was over-the-top spectacular, and the experience was out of this world. What a privilege to finish our trip there!”

– Dan and Stephanie, traveling with friends on a two-week trip through Patagonia, Argentina, and Chile; their 3rd Knowmad trip.

ARGENTINA & CHILE ADVENTURE: PATAGONIA & BEYOND

Buenos Aires

 

DAY 1 USA – Buenos Aires
Take an overnight flight, arriving in Buenos Aires the following morning.

 

DAY 2 Buenos Aires
In Buenos Aires, you will be taken to your accommodations by your Knowmad guide.

  • No meals – Legado Mitico, Deluxe Room

 

DAY 3 Buenos Aires
Enjoy a guided half-day exploration of Buenos Aires, visiting neighborhoods such as San Telmo and La Boca. You will also explore the Recoleta district which includes South America’s most opulent cemetery. Included will be a guided walk through Teatro Colón, rated one of the best opera houses in the world.

  • B – Legado Mitico

 

Argentina Cooking Class

 

DAY 4 Buenos Aires
Learn about Buenos Aires’ Jewish heritage on today’s guided, half-day historical and cultural discovery of the city’s Jewish communities. While visiting the most important Jewish sites and monuments, such as Plaza de la Memoria, the AMIA Jewish federation and local synagogues, your guide will explain the history and evolution of the Jewish porteños and their influence in the city. Later, take part in an asado experience: an open fire cooking class where you’ll enjoy premium meat and wine as you discover this local Argentine tradition.

  • B, D – Legado Mitico

 

DAY 5 Buenos Aires – El Calafate
Transfer with your Spanish-speaking driver to the airport. In Calafate, transfer to your accommodations with a Knowmad guide.

  • B – Esplendor, Lake View Room

 

Experiencing ranch life at an estancia

 

Perito Moreno Glacier

 

DAY 6 Perito Moreno Glacier
Visit a remote estancia to experience ranch life and enjoy a traditional asado (today in a shared group). Then board a small vessel, stopping for a short hike before boating to the face of the glacier. Exploring the walkways and various viewpoints to witness the thundering of ice carvings.

  • B, L – Esplendor, Lake View Room

DAY 7 El Calafate, Argentina – Torres del Paine National Park, Chile
Take the shared-guest transfer across the border to Torres del Paine. Due to customs and border crossing, total travel time may be around 4-6 hours. While at your lodge, enjoy a range of small group excursions, gourmet food and a variety of alcoholic beverages. Guides will explain the excursion options each night to plan your activities for the next day.

  • B, L (*dependent on arrival time), D – Explora Torres del Paine, Cordillera Paine Room

 

Torres del Paine

 

DaYs 8,9,10 Torres del Paine National Park
Continue enjoying your adventures at the lodge and throughout Torres del Paine.

  • B, L, D – Explora Torres del Paine, Cordillera Paine Room

 

Day 11 Torres del Paine National Park – Puerto Natales – Santiago – Valparaíso
Transfer by shared-guest transfer to Puerto Natales airport (2-hours). In Santiago, transfer with your guide ~90 minutes to your accommodations in the coastal city of Valparaíso.

  • B – Casa Higueras, Premium Superior Room

 

Valparaíso

 

Day 12 Valparaíso
Enjoy a walking exploration of Valparaíso and its hills. Visit Echaurren Square, the origins of the Port, the old banking area, and Concepción and Alegre Hills, home to handicraft and artist workshops.

  • B – Casa Higueras

 

DAY 13 Valparaíso – Colchagua Valley
Transfer with your guide around 3 ½ hours to the Fuegos de Apalta restaurant for lunch (to be paid directly by travelers). Then, continue in the same transfer to your nearby accommodations nestled in the hills of the Colchagua Valley. While at Clos Apalta, enjoy the activities and gourmet meals included in your stay.

  • B, D – Clos Apalta Residence, Villa

 

Clos Apalta Wine Country

 

DAY 14 Colchagua Valley
Enjoy the on-site facilities, visit the cellar in a private tour and tasting, and walk/bike through the vineyard during your day at leisure.

  • B, L, D – Clos Apalta Residence, Villa

 

DAY 15 Colchagua Valley – Santiago – USA
Enjoy the day at Clos Apalta. Transfer ~2.5 hours with your Spanish-speaking driver to the airport for your international flight home.

  • B, L

 

wine country - clos apalta residence, Chile

 

DAY 16 USA
Arrive home.
